"Customer Care for the Hospitality Industry" Classes

Our mission is to make Wake County the most hospitable county in the world! To help us reach that goal, we offer quarterly classes called Customer Care for the Hospitality Industry.

COURSE CONTENT:

This is a hands-on, interactive class that offers practical tips and techniques in customer service. Participants will share ideas and stories with their peers and gain insight from a diverse group of industry professionals.

EXAMPLES OF COURSE COMPONENTS INCLUDE:

Outstanding Service, Working as Part of a Team, Guest Challenges and Telephone Techniques. Your trainer will be Jane Ann Broden, instructor for Hotel/Restaurant Management, Wake Technical Community College.

WHO SHOULD ATTEND:

Hourly associates who will benefit directly from the training, key associates who serve as role models for their businesses or supervisors and managers who will take the class as a "train the trainer" opportunity.

MORE INFORMAITON:

This course is sponsored by the Greater Raleigh Community Hospitality Partnership (GRCHP). The GRCHP is a collective group of the area's hotels, restaurants, visitor attractions and hospitality service providers working together with GRCVB, Wake Technical Community College and the N.C. Restaurant and Lodging Association. This partnership is focused on developing means to establish Raleigh and Wake County as a destination known for great customer service.
